Melinda Garcia and Rene Govea Identified as Victims in Deadly Weber Road Crash

Corpus Christi, TX – Authorities have identified the two victims killed in Sunday morning’s fatal crash on Weber Road as 50-year-old Melinda Garcia and 45-year-old Rene Govea, according to the Nueces County Medical Examiner’s Office.

The tragic collision occurred around 6:30 a.m. on September 14, 2025, near Tripoli Drive, involving a black Cadillac Escalade and a gray BMW.

Police say Garcia was a passenger in the Escalade, while Govea was driving the BMW. Investigators determined that the Escalade, traveling northbound, failed to yield while making a left turn, resulting in the southbound BMW striking it.

The violent crash caused all three people inside the Escalade to be ejected. The female driver and Garcia, who was the front-seat passenger, were rushed to a local hospital with life-threatening injuries. Sadly, Garcia later died from her injuries. The back passenger, a male, survived with non-life-threatening injuries.

Govea, the BMW driver, was pronounced dead at the scene. His female passenger was transported to the hospital in serious condition.

According to the Corpus Christi Police Department, the driver of the Escalade is facing pending charges of Intoxication Manslaughter and Intoxication Assault.

The road was shut down for several hours as investigators examined the scene. Authorities confirmed the crash remains under active investigation.
